28.06.2022 16:56Cities of the future may be built with algae-grown limestone
Global cement production accounts for 7% of annual greenhouse gas emissions in large part through the burning of quarried limestone. Now, a CU Boulder-led research team has figured out a way to make cement production carbon neutral—and even carbon negative—by pulling carbon dioxide out of the air with the help of microalgae.

15.06.2022 16:33Holcim invests in innovative carbon mineralization solution
Holcim announced its financial investment in Blue Planet Systems Corporation, a US-based start-up whose patented mineralization technology is a unique scalable method for capturing and permanently sequestering millions of tons of CO2

TITAN Group is expanding its effective capacity in the USA with a new $37 million investment in its Norfolk import terminal in Virginia. The investment will upgrade TITAN’s import capacity in the country while also allowing it to continue expanding its offering of low carbon cement and cementitious products, contributing to the Group’s net-zero goal.
